Body
We are called to live life in the world but not of the world (1-6).
Following Jesus needs to be a part of your life outside the walls of this church (1-2).
You have been placed on the mission field in your day-to-day life (3-5).
No matter your title or position remember you follow Christ (6).
Image: My mission field, LNK - what is your mission field?
MTR: Reflect on the world in which you live and consider "What is my mission field?"
Therefore, you can expect to encounter temptation (7-10).
On the mission field you will encounter people who do not understand that you follow Christ (7).
On the mission field you will be presented with seemingly minor temptations (8-9).
On the mission field you will be presented with reasonable arguments to disobey (10).
Image: Nobody would really know if I just did a touch-and-go at night!
MTR: Ask yourself, what temptations am I facing on the mission field?
Remember, that obedience is worth it even when it seems nobody is watching (11-21)!
On the mission field you will be presented with opportunities to stand in obedience (11-14).
On the mission field you will be presented with opportunities to see God's blessing (15-17).
On the mission field others should notice that there is something different about you (18-21).
MTR: Look for opportunities to give God the glory for the blessing you receive on the field.
